Please provide a way to clear the Cache fields for user-input fields. Example: Forwarding a ticket to a different email address. Begin typing in the "TO:" field. Proposed text contains every mis-spelled email address ever entered. There must be a way to clear this cache or remove the suggestion all together.

You can remove the offending email addresses via the FogBugz XML API. You don't need to be a coder to do this. It can be done with a browser. Here's a tutorial involving zombies.

This is your browser, not Fogbugz. Some browsers allow you to delete autocomplete info by scrolling down to it and pressing the delete key.
